Salary Guide for Teachers in Wheelers Hill

📊 Teacher salaries in Wheelers Hill align with Victorian scales, adjusted for suburb affluence. Base for Level 1 Primary/Secondary: $77,000; experienced (10+ years) up to $113,000, plus allowances ($3k-$10k). Factors: Qualifications (Masters +2-5%), school type (private higher), performance pay. Cost of living: 10% above national avg, but salaries competitive. Superannuation 11.5%, benefits include laptops, wellness programs. National avg $95k; Wheelers Hill 5% higher due to demand.

Weather and Climate in Wheelers Hill

☀️ Wheelers Hill enjoys Melbourne's temperate oceanic climate: Summers (Dec-Feb) avg 26°C highs/14°C lows, sunny for park excursions. Winters (Jun-Aug) 14°C/7°C, occasional frost but mild for indoor focus. Annual rainfall 650mm, evenly spread; rare extremes. Impacts: Summer outdoor sports thrive at Jells Park; wet springs suit library projects. Tips: Layer for variable days; best visit Oct-Apr. Enhances work-life with bike commutes year-round. Lifestyle and Cost of Living in Wheelers Hill

📍 Family haven with parks (Jells), shopping (Brandon Park), cafes. Median house $1.45M, rent $550/wk (2-bed). Groceries $150/wk/person, 8% above national. Transport: Buses/trains to CBD 30min, low car reliance. Culture: Festivals, sports clubs; outdoor lifestyle. Teachers benefit: Affordable daycare, safe streets. Compare: 15% higher COL than avg VIC, offset by salaries. Vibrant for families. (305 words)
